several prehistoric archaeological sites discovered within urban area of beirut, revealing flint tools of sequential periods dating middle paleolithic , upper paleolithic through neolithic bronze age.


beirut i, or minet el hosn, listed beyrouth ville louis burkhalter , said on beach near orent , bassoul hotels on avenue des français in central beirut. site discovered lortet in 1894 , discussed godefroy zumoffen in 1900. flint industry site described mousterian , held museum of fine arts of lyon.


beirut ii, or umm el khatib, suggested burkhalter have been south of tarik el jedideh, p.e. gigues discovered copper age flint industry @ around 100 metres (328 feet) above sea level. site had been built on , destroyed 1948.


beirut iii, furn esh shebbak or plateau tabet, suggested have been located on left bank of beirut river. burkhalter suggested west of damascus road, although determination has been criticized lorraine copeland. p. e. gigues discovered series of neolithic flint tools on surface along remains of structure suggested hut circle. auguste bergy discussed polished axes found @ site, has disappeared result of construction , urbanization of area.


beirut iv, or furn esh shebbak, river banks, on left bank of river , on either side of road leading eastwards furn esh shebbak police station towards river marked city limits. area covered in red sand represented quaternary river terraces. site found jesuit father dillenseger , published fellow jesuits godefroy zumoffen, raoul describes , auguste bergy. collections site made bergy, describes , jesuit, paul bovier-lapierre. large number of middle paleolithic flint tools found on surface , in side gullies drain river. included around 50 varied bifaces accredited acheulean period, lustrous sheen, held @ museum of lebanese prehistory. henri fleisch found emireh point amongst material site, has disappeared beneath buildings.


beirut v, or nahr beirut (beirut river), discovered dillenseger , said in orchard of mulberry trees on left bank of river, near river mouth, , close railway station , bridge tripoli. levallois flints , bones , similar surface material found amongst brecciated deposits. area has been built on.


beirut vi, or patriarchate, site discovered while building on property of lebanese evangelical school girls in patriarchate area of beirut. notable discovery of finely styled canaanean blade javelin suggested date néolithique ancien or néolithique moyen periods of byblos , held in school library.


beirut vii, or rivoli cinema , byblos cinema sites near bourj in rue el arz area, 2 sites discovered lorraine copeland , peter wescombe in 1964 , examined diana kirkbride , roger saidah. 1 site behind parking lot of byblos cinema , showed collapsed walls, pits, floors, charcoal, pottery , flints. other, overlooking cliff west of rivoli cinema, composed of 3 layers resting on limestone bedrock. fragments of blades , broad flakes recovered first layer of black soil, above bronze age pottery recovered in layer of grey soil. pieces of roman pottery , mosaics found in upper layer. middle bronze age tombs found in area, , ancient tell of beirut thought in bourj area.


the phoenician port of beirut located between rue foch , rue allenby on north coast. port or harbor excavated , reported on several years ago , lies buried under city. suggested port or dry dock claimed have been discovered ~1 kilometre (0.62 miles) west, in 2011 team of lebanese archaeologists directorate general of antiquities of lebanese university. controversy arose on 26 june 2012 when authorization given lebanese minister of culture gaby layoun private company called venus towers real estate development company destroy ruins (archaeological site bey194) in $500 million construction project of 3 skyscrapers , garden behind hotel monroe in downtown beirut. 2 later reports international committee of archaeologists appointed layoun, including hanz curver, , expert report ralph pederson, member of institute of nautical archaeology , teaching @ marburg in germany, dismissed claims trenches port, on various criteria. exact function of site bey194 may never discovered, , issue raised heated emotions , led increased coverage on subject of lebanese heritage in press.
